Output 6c23309c5f3b409c3410611d66acb460390c766194e46f8450e287a79023277b:5

value
519266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c216d1bc9a1aab26904a52bf6434c4ed94eaac1 OP_EQUAL
address
3MkxdEsHg7dSiyK8CFMd72tohKAnQ1Vp14
transaction
6c23309c5f3b409c3410611d66acb460390c766194e46f8450e287a79023277b
spent
true